Penfolds, founded in 1844 in South Australia, is one of the most celebrated names in Australian winemaking. Known globally for its exceptional quality and craftsmanship, Penfolds blends heritage with innovation, producing iconic wines that consistently earn critical acclaim. The Koonunga Hill range reflects Penfolds’ philosophy of accessible excellence, offering bold character and refined balance.
Penfolds Koonunga Hill Seventy Six Shiraz Cabernet opens with aromas of blackberry, plum, and blackcurrant, layered with hints of vanilla, spice, and oak. On the palate, it is full-bodied and smooth, with ripe dark fruit, peppery spice, and fine tannins. The finish is long and balanced, with lingering notes of chocolate and subtle oak – a true showcase of classic Aussie red blend character.
